0 CommentsThe State Department warns U.S. citizens of ‘the risks of traveling to Israel, the West Bank and Gaza due to ongoing hostilities’ and advises deferring non-essential travel.
The security environment remains complex in Israel, the West Bank, and Gaza, and US citizens need to be aware of the risks of travel to these areas because of the current conflict between Hamas and Israel. Travelers should avoid areas of Israel in the vicinity of the Gaza Strip due to the real risks presented by small arms fire, anti-tank weapons, rockets, and mortars, as attacks from Gaza can come with little or no warning
The U.S. embassy in Tel Aviv is working on reduced staffing and providing only emergency consular services, however is says it is not evacuating U.S. citizens out of Israel
